BL> What would make the Sprortie think it was BUSY when it wasn't? RB> It is a bit of a mistery, but This happens in about 20% of my RB> calls to a Meastro VFc. I have to think that it is either the RB> Maestro or the exchange triggering my modem to go to busy. RB> Doesnt happen to any other calls I make. Yair... I disabled BUSY-detect as Paul suggested and now it works. The strange part is that I've been calling TML for 3 years and only now it starts doing it... after Paul changes modems.
